Suellen Lee
Maximum Carry-On
In Maximum Carry-On, Suellen Lee continues her exploration of abstraction, moving into a more fluid and gestural visual language. The works are shaped by an intimate response to her local environment, alongside reflections on a wider world that feels increasingly fractured.
At the heart of the exhibition is the idea of “carry-on” — the emotional baggage we accumulate and the way it subtly colours how we see, feel, and move through space. Lee is particularly drawn to the built environment, and several works reference airport terminals: places designed to funnel bodies efficiently, yet rich with striking colour, form, and negative space. Airports become both subject and metaphor — transitional, controlled, emotionally charged — where private inner worlds travel quietly through public systems.
Suellen Lee lives in South Gippsland and holds a Diploma in Visual Arts. She has exhibited at Stockyard Gallery, Gecko Gallery, and Meeniyan Gallery.
